Exit polling is a popular technique used to determine the outcome of an election prior to results being tallied. Suppose a referendum to increase funding for education is on the ballot in a large town​ (voting population over​ 100,000). An exit poll of 200 voters finds that 94 voted for the referendum. How likely are the results of your sample if the population proportion of voters in the town in favor of the referendum is 0.52​? Based on your​ result, comment on the dangers of using exit polling to call elections.

Answers

Answer:

P(X ≤ 94) =  0.09012

From what we observe; There is a probability  of less than 94 people who voted for the referendum is 0.09012

Comment:

The result is unusual because the probability that p is equal to or more extreme than the sample proportion is greater than 5%. Thus, it is not unusual for a wrong call to be made in an election if the exit polling alone is considered.

Step-by-step explanation:

From the information given :

An exit poll of 200 voters finds that 94 voted for the referendum.

How likely are the results of your sample if the population proportion of voters in the town in favor of the referendum is 0.52​? Based on your​ result, comment on the dangers of using exit polling to call elections.

This implies that ;

the Sample size n = 200

the probability p = 0.52

Let X be the random variable

So; the Binomial expression can be represented as:

X [tex]\sim[/tex] Binomial ( n = 200, p = 0.52)

Mean [tex]\mu[/tex] = np

Mean [tex]\mu[/tex]  = 200 × 0.52

Mean [tex]\mu[/tex]  = 104

The standard deviation [tex]\sigma[/tex] = [tex]\sqrt{np(1-p)}[/tex]

The standard deviation [tex]\sigma[/tex] = [tex]\sqrt{200 \times 0.52(1-0.52)}[/tex]

The standard deviation [tex]\sigma[/tex] = [tex]\sqrt{200 \times 0.52(0.48)}[/tex]

The standard deviation [tex]\sigma[/tex] = [tex]\sqrt{49.92}[/tex]

The standard deviation [tex]\sigma[/tex] = 7.065

However;

P(X ≤ 94) because the discrete distribution by the continuous normal distribution values lies in the region of 93.5 and 94.5 .

The less than or equal to sign therefore relates to the continuous normal distribution of X < 94.5

Now;

x = 94.5

Therefore;

[tex]z = \dfrac{x- \mu}{\sigma}[/tex]

[tex]z = \dfrac{94.5 - 104}{7.065}[/tex]

[tex]z = \dfrac{-9.5}{7.065}[/tex]

z = −1.345

P(X< 94.5) = P(Z < - 1.345)

From the z- table

P(X ≤ 94) =  0.09012

From what we observe; There is a probability  of less than 94 people who voted for the referendum is 0.09012

Comment:

The result is unusual because the probability that p is equal to or more extreme than the sample proportion is greater than 5%. Thus, it is not unusual for a wrong call to be made in an election if the exit polling alone is considered.

In how many ways can you put seven marbles in different colors into four jars? Note that the jars may be empty.

Answers

Answer: 16,384

Step-by-step explanation:

The seven marbles have different colours, so we can differentiate them.

Now, suppose that for each marble we have a selection, where the selection is in which jar we put it.

For the first marble, we have 4 options ( we have 4 jars)

For the second marble, we have 4 options.

Same for the third, for the fourth, etc.

Now, the total number of combinations is equal to the product of the number of options for each selection.

We have 7 selections and 4 options for each selection, then the total number of combinations is:

C = 4^7 = 16,384

A ladder is leaning against a wall at an angle of 70° with the ground. The distance along the ground is 86cm. Find the length of the ladder

Answers

Answer:

[tex]\boxed{x = 251.4 cm}[/tex]

Step-by-step explanation:

Part 1: Sketching the triangle

We are given the angle of elevation, 70°, and the distance along the ground, 86 centimeters. Our unknown is a ladder leaning against the building. Buildings are erected vertically, so the unknown side length is the hypotenuse of the triangle.

We can then sketch this triangle out to visualize it (attachment).

Part 2: Determining what trigonometric ratio can solve the problem

Now, we need to refer to our three trigonometric ratios:

[tex]sin = \frac{opposite}{hypotenuse}[/tex]

[tex]cos = \frac{adjacent}{hypotenuse}[/tex]

[tex]tan = \frac{opposite}{adjacent}[/tex]

Visualizing the sketched triangle, we can assign the three sides their terms in correspondence to the known angle -- this angle cannot be the right angle because the hypotenuse is opposite of it.

Therefore, we know our unknown side length is the hypotenuse of the triangle and because the other side is bordering the 70° angle, it is the adjacent side.

By assigning the sides, we can see that we need to use the trigonometric function that utilizes both the hypotenuse and the adjacent side to find the angle. This is the cosine function.

Part 3: Solving for the unknown variable

Now that we have determined what side we need to solve for and what trigonometric function we are going to use to do so, we just need to plug it all into the equation.

The cosine function is provided: [tex]cos( \alpha) = \frac{adjacent}{hypotenuse}[/tex], where [tex]\alpha[/tex] is the angle. We just need to plug in our values and solve for our unknown side; the hypotenuse.

[tex]cos (70) = \frac{86 cm}{x}[/tex], where x is the unknown side/the hypotenuse.

[tex]x * cos (70) = \frac{86 cm}{x} * x[/tex] Multiply by x on both sides of the equation to eliminate the denominator and make the unknown easier to solve for.

[tex]\frac{xcos (70)}{cos(70)} = \frac{86 cm}{cos(70)}[/tex], Evaluate the second fraction because the first one cancels down to just the unknown, x.

[tex]\frac{86}{cos(70)} = 251.4[/tex], round to one decimal place.

Your final answer is [tex]\boxed{x=251.4cm}[/tex].
